The 2025–26 Irani Cup was the 62nd edition of the Irani Cup, a first-class cricket tournament in India, organised by the Board of Control for Cricket in India (BCCI). It was played as a one-off match between Vidarbha, the winners of the 2024–25 Ranji Trophy, and a Rest of India cricket team.[1]
It took place from 1 to 5 October 2025 in Nagpur. The tournament was part of the 2025 Indian domestic cricket season, announced by the BCCI in June 2025.[2] Mumbai were the defending champions.[3]
